Teachers don’t respect every student equally in school education. Actually, they more inclined to respect those who do well in study, family background, parents and teachers have the interests of the exchanges and contacts. The phenomenon, that discriminating people’s dignity because of the external factors of the man, is called selective respect. There are many characteristics in selective respect, like surface, relativity, and frail, grade, utilitarian and snobbish. Selective respect in school has something different particularity, for example, easily occur, not sensitive, large lethality. Selective respect is not the real respect, which based on one’s morality, personality and equal rights. However, the selective respect is in view of people’s power, wealth, and reputation and so on. The mendacious selective respect is the helper to the reproduction of social estate.It also damage human nature, as well as interpersonal relationship and psychology. This paper, which from four aspects about hierarchy, utilitarianism, over-competition, system of education, is tried to reveal the origin of selective respect. In order to solve the problem of selective respect, this paper also put forward a proposal about universal respect in school life, where every student’s personality and rights are respected equally.
